NVIDIA GeForce GT 1010 vs ATI FirePro V8700 Duo

We compared two Desktop platform GPUs: 2GB VRAM GeForce GT 1010 and 1024MB VRAM FirePro V8700 Duo to see which GPU has better performance in key specifications, benchmark tests, power consumption, etc.

Main Differences

NVIDIA GeForce GT 1010 's Advantages
Boost Clock1468MHz
More VRAM (2GB vs 1GB)
Lower TDP (30W vs 151W)
ATI FirePro V8700 Duo 's Advantages
Larger VRAM bandwidth (108.8GB/s vs 48.06GB/s)
544 additional rendering cores
